    Bis(tetra­phenyl­phospho­nium) bis­[N-(phenyl­sulfon­yl)dithio­carbimato-κ2 S,S′]platinate(II) monohydrate

    The asymmetric unit of the title compound, (C24H20P)2[Pt(C7H5NO2S3)2]·H2O, consists of two tetra­phenyl­phospho­nium cations, two half bis­[N-(phenyl­sulfon­yl)dithio­carbim­ato]platinate(II) dianions and one water mol­ecule. The anions are completed by crystallographic inversion symmetry associated with the central PtII ion. The PtII ion is doubly S,S′-chelated by two symmetry-related phenyl­sulfonyl­dithio­carbimate ligands, forming a slightly distorted square-planar configuration. Besides the electrostatic attraction between oppositely charged ions in the crystal packing, intra­molecular C—H⋯O and several inter­molecular C—H⋯O, C—H⋯N and O—H⋯O hydrogen-bonding inter­actions between the cations, anions and water mol­ecules are observed

    Bis(tetra­phenyl­phospho­nium) bis­[N-(trifluoro­methyl­sulfon­yl)dithio­carbimato(2−)-κ2 S,S′]zincate(II)

    The title salt, (C24H20P)2[Zn(C2F3NO2S3)2], consists of a complex dianion and two tetra­phenyl­phospho­nium cations. The ZnII ion displays a distorted tetra­hedral coordination environment with four S atoms from two S,S′-chelated N-(trifluoro­methyl­sulfonyl­)dithio­carbimate anions. In the crystal, besides the ionic inter­action of the oppositely charged ions, inter­molecular C—H⋯O inter­actions between cations and anions are observed. One of the cations inter­acts with an inversion-related equivalent by π–π stacking between phenyl rings, with a centroid–centroid distance of 3.932 (4) Å

    The Effects of Financial Literacy, Self-Efficacy and Self-Coping on Financial Behavior of Emerging Adults

    This study examines the relationship between financial behavior, financial literacy, self-efficacy, and self-coping among emerging adults. The study population is 790 respondents from 11 Credit Counselling and Debt Management (CCDM). Statistical Package for Social Science (SPSS) was used to analyze Pearson Correlation and Multiple regression. It was used to determine the relationships and recognize determinants of emerging adults’ financial behavior respectively. In this study, financial literacy, self-efficacy, self-coping, and financial behavior variables were entered into the regression. A total of 790 respondents aged 40 and below were selected. An independent sample t-test was administered to compare the financial behavior scores for females and males. The results reveal that there was significant difference in the mean of financial behavior scores for females (M = 87.20, SD = 18.00) and males (M = 89.70, SD = 16.80; t (765) = 2.010, p = 0.045, two-tailed). The multiple regression results indicate that the model explained 13.4% of the variance in financial behavior, which is predicted significantly by the model (F = 38.361, p = 0.000). This study will be beneficial to policymakers to improve living conditions and to promote good financial behavior, financial literacy, self-efficacy as well as self-coping especially for emerging adults in Malaysia

    Banco de sementes do solo para uso na recuperação de matas ciliares degradadas na região Noroeste fluminense.

    O objetivo deste trabalho foi caracterizar a capacidade de germinação e diversidade das espécies do banco de sementes de um fragmento de mata ciliar localizado na Estação Experimental da Empresa de Pesquisa Agropecuária do Estado do Rio de Janeiro (PESAGRO-RJ), em Itaocara - RJ e, com isso, avaliar o seu potencial para uso em técnicas de nucleação. Amostras de 0,25 m x 0,25 m x 0,05 m de solo e serapilheira foram coletadas em cinco diferentes pontos do fragmento, a cada 10 m, a partir da margem do rio Paraíba do Sul. Em cada distância foram tomadas três amostras de solo e três amostras de solo + serapilheira. O material coletado foi levado à Universidade Estadual do Norte Fluminense (UENF) e disposto em bandejas plásticas de 25 cm de diâmetro e 9 cm de altura, em casa de vegetação. Os tratamentos foram dispostos em delineamento inteiramente casualizado (DIC) e comparados pelo teste de F (5%), com 15 repetições por tratamento, constituídas por uma bandeja. Durante um período de quatro meses, foram registrados 473 indivíduos, distribuídos entre herbáceos, arbustivos e arbóreos. O banco de sementes avaliado é composto, em sua maioria, por espécies herbáceas, destacando-se a Pteridium arachnoideum, com 58 indivíduos. Dentre as espécies arbustivas e arbóreas, destacaram-se Piper sp. e Trema micrantha, com 56 e 32 indivíduos, respectivamente. O banco de sementes do solo, juntamente com a serapilheira, apresentou menor número de espécies, sem diferença no número de indivíduos. Tanto o solo, quanto o solo com serapilheira apresentam potencial para uso em técnicas de nucleação

    Towards Urban Geopolitics of Encounter: Spatial Mixing in Contested Jerusalem

    The extent to which 'geographies of encounter' facilitate tolerance of diversity and difference has long been a source of debate in urban studies and human geography scholarship. However, to date this contestation has focused primarily on hyper-diverse cities in the global north-west. Adapting this debate to the volatile conditions of the nationally-contested city, this paper explores intergroup encounters between Israelis and Palestinians in Jerusalem. The paper suggests that in the context of hyper-polarisation of the nationally-contested urban space, the study of encounter should focus on macro-scale structural forces. In Jerusalem, we stress the role of ethnonationality and neoliberalism as key producers of its asymmetric and volatile yet highly resilient geography of intergroup encounters. In broader sense, as many cities worldwide experience a resurgence of ethnonationalism, illuminating the structural production of encounter may demarcate a broader function for reading contemporary urban geopolitics
